Transaction 5654d549f4a062234a4877193d0c13ae2899907764395a6e4188a5782ef0b2fa
1 Input
2 Outputs
- 5654d549f4a062234a4877193d0c13ae2899907764395a6e4188a5782ef0b2fa:0
- 5654d549f4a062234a4877193d0c13ae2899907764395a6e4188a5782ef0b2fa:1
value 522736
address 1DEdByui2Y5PoM3at2BgLqy65dNXDqajTH
value 541726
address 3EpNAQLGBNKRqCm5zdkjo1wD32Qj2dh2Ej